🐕 ABOUT YOU
You’ll ideally have significant hands-on experience working with dogs in a professional environment and be confident:
• Reading dog body language, including subtle signs of stress, discomfort, over-arousal and escalation
• Assessing healthy and appropriate dog-to-dog play, with an understanding of MARS
• Managing a group of dogs safely and proactively
• Recognising when intervention is needed before situations escalate
• Redirecting inappropriate or over-aroused behaviour
• Using basic training skills and positive reinforcement within a group environment
• Encouraging and reinforcing calm, appropriate behaviour
• Making confident, sensible decisions independently in a busy daycare environment
❤️ OUR PHILOSOPHY
Westford Co Golden Grove is proudly force-free, and this is non-negotiable.
We do not use fear, intimidation, physical corrections or aversive handling to manage dogs.
We’re looking for someone who doesn’t simply agree to follow a force-free policy at work, but genuinely shares our philosophy and understands why the emotional wellbeing of the dogs in our care matters just as much as their physical safety.
If concepts like consent in play, displacement, reinforcement, redirection, capturing calm behaviour and proactive management are already part of your vocabulary, you may be exactly who we’re looking for! 🐶
